On Saturday, Economic Minister for the Japanese government responsible for the economic response to the coronavirus pandemic called off all his public appearance and will instead work from home after he came into contact with a university worker infected with the coronavirus.
The Cabinet Office reported that the Economy Minister Yasutoshi Nishimura already canceled a media briefing and would not attend a separate meeting later in the day.
The office said in a statement that Nishimura had visited a university hospital with a staff member who tested positive for the virus later.
